Abstract :
Taguchi method is the most popular approach for multiresponse optimization. However, the weighting values of responses are ignored in this approach. Thus improved Taguchi method is presented, which applies the principal component analysis to evaluate the weights so that their relative importance can be properly described. The implementation and effectiveness of the proposed method are illustrated by an example from the literature. The results show that improved Taguchi method can optimize the multiresponses.
